SOUTH WEST AFRICA AND UNION

STATEMENT BY UNION PRIME MINISTER (Rec. 8 p.m.) CAPE TOWN, Sept. 1. The Prime Minister of South Africa (Dr. Malan) told Parliament that South Africa had refused to ask the United Nations for permission to incorporate South-West Africa in the Union because the Nationalist Government thought it could take steps by legislation “or otherwise” to bring the two territories closer together.
